
Croque-Monsieur
A grilled ham and cheese sandwich that is a classic French cafe snack.
Ingredients
- •White bread
- •Ham
- •Gruyère cheese
- •Béchamel sauce
Instructions
Make Béchamel Sauce
Prepare a creamy béchamel sauce on the stovetop.
Assemble Sandwich
Layer the bread, ham, and Gruyère cheese, then top with the béchamel sauce.
Grill Sandwich
Cook the sandwich in a pan or on a grill until the bread is crisp and the cheese is melted.
The Croque-Monsieur is a quintessential French cafe snack that has delighted taste buds for generations. This delectable grilled ham and cheese sandwich is a perfect blend of simplicity and indulgence, making it a favorite among both locals and tourists.
The origins of the Croque-Monsieur can be traced back to early 20th century Paris, where it first appeared on cafe menus. The name "Croque-Monsieur" literally translates to "Mister Crunch," a nod to the sandwich's crispy exterior. Over the years, it has become a staple in French cuisine, enjoyed by people of all ages.
To make a Croque-Monsieur, start by preparing a creamy béchamel sauce on the stovetop. This rich sauce is made from butter, flour, and milk, and is seasoned with a pinch of nutmeg. Next, assemble the sandwich by layering slices of white bread with ham and Gruyère cheese. Top the sandwich with a generous amount of béchamel sauce, then grill it in a pan or on a grill until the bread is crisp and the cheese is melted.
There are several ways to customize a Croque-Monsieur. Some variations include adding a fried egg on top, transforming it into a Croque-Madame. Others might experiment with different types of cheese or bread to create unique flavor combinations. No matter how you choose to customize it, the Croque-Monsieur remains a delicious and satisfying treat.
In France, the Croque-Monsieur is typically served as a quick snack or light meal. It is often enjoyed with a side salad or a cup of coffee, making it a perfect choice for a leisurely cafe lunch. The sandwich's rich flavors and comforting texture make it a beloved part of French culinary culture.
